The DS30B rapid-fire cannon is a 30 mm Oerlikon stabilized, ship-protection system created by MSI-Defence Systems and controlled by a single operator.

Contents

Description

The DS30B system consists of a marinized, stabilized gun mount which accommodates the Oerlikon KCB 30 mm cannon. The DS30B is the predecessor to the 30mm DS30M Mark 2 Automated Small Calibre Gun, which mounts a 30 mm Mark 44 Bushmaster II.
